技术文摘
2019 年前端工程师的自检清单及思考
2019 年前端工程师的自检清单及思考
在前端领域,技术的更新换代可谓日新月异。作为 2019 年的前端工程师,我们需要不断审视自己的技能和知识,以适应行业的发展。以下是一份自检清单及相关思考,希望能帮助我们在前端之路上走得更稳更远。
基础的 HTML、CSS 和 JavaScript 知识是否扎实?能否熟练运用 HTML5 的新标签和语义化元素,写出结构清晰、易于维护的页面?对于 CSS3 的各种动画效果、媒体查询和弹性布局,是否能信手拈来?而在 JavaScript 方面,是否深入理解了原型链、闭包、异步编程等核心概念?
前端框架和库的掌握程度如何?Vue.js、React 或者 Angular 等主流框架,是否有实际项目经验?能否高效地利用框架的特性来构建复杂的应用?对于相关的状态管理库,如 Redux 或 Vuex,是否能合理运用来管理应用的状态?
性能优化是前端不可忽视的重要环节。是否了解页面加载性能的优化策略,如代码压缩、图片优化、懒加载等?对于前端的缓存机制,是否能灵活运用以提高页面的响应速度?
另外,移动前端开发的能力也至关重要。是否熟悉移动端的适配方案,能够确保页面在各种尺寸的移动设备上都有良好的展示效果?对于混合应用开发框架,如 Cordova 或 React Native,是否有一定的了解和实践?
还有,前端工程化的理念是否融入到日常工作中?是否熟悉自动化构建工具,如 Webpack 或 Gulp?能否通过版本控制系统有效地管理代码?
最后,持续学习的能力和对新技术的敏感度也是衡量前端工程师的重要标准。是否关注前端领域的最新动态,及时学习和尝试新的技术和工具?
作为 2019 年的前端工程师,我们要不断对照这份自检清单,发现自身的不足并加以改进。前端领域充满了挑战和机遇,只有不断提升自己,才能在这个快速发展的行业中立足。让我们以积极的态度和行动,迎接未来的前端挑战,为创造更优秀的用户体验而努力。
- 从 SPserver 至 BRPC
- 职场人乱用 Emoji 表情或被起诉,请注意!
- Asciinema - 终端日志记录的绝佳工具,开发者的必备利器
- Python 助力实现可视化 GUI 界面,一键替换证件照背景颜色
- 浅析契约测试
- Vue3 中处于实验性阶段的 Suspense 是什么?
- RabbitMQ 宕机后,消息是否 100%不丢失
- 2022 年,Babel 与 TypeScript 谁更适配代码编译
- 前端项目中 Node 版本与包管理器的统一方法
- C 语言匿名的巅峰之境
- JS 如何提升 Web 输入体验:自动配对标点符号
- 三种主流企业架构模式图解
- RabbitMQ 向 RocketMQ 平滑迁移的技术实战
- 微前端 qiankun 多页签缓存方案的实践
- 掌握 Reflect Metadata 就能明白 Nest 的实现原理